Sybil Irene Sirak, age 90,
of Girard,Erie,pa,
died Tuesday, January 25, 2011,
She was born in Potsdam, N.Y.,
on October 13, 1920, a daughter of the late James Perry and Blanche Evans Kingston. Sybil attended various public schools in New York State prior to moving to Erie's west county area, ultimately settling in Fairview Township where she raised her family. In addition to her roles as mother and housewife, Sybil had employment with Lord Manufacturing, Erisco Wire Products, Poly-Tronics and Sunburst Electronics. She enjoyed having her family on hand for holidays and summer picnics and travelling throughout the U.S. with her husband.
Sybil was preceded in death by her husband of 49 years, Joseph G. Sirak,
two sisters, Mildred Kingston and Shirley Schneider and her son-in-law, Robert Heiges. She is survived by three children: Sheryl Heiges of Waterford, Nancy Rothrock and her husband Bob of Mentor, Ohio, Joseph Sirak and his wife Cynthia of Girard; two grandchildren: Melissa Koma and her husband David, Joseph Sirak and his wife Michelle, all of Girard; four great-grandchildren, Megan, Lauren, Peyton and Dawson Koma of Girard; a sister, Betty DeMichael and her husband Richard of Girard; as well as two nieces and a nephew.
